Output bcecc7919274a3aa11a14ccfbf66f8c975937e2ea6be4a1873fd77a9b1405606:1

value
20478139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855eeb0c03b0509481c0af7830eeec5ab837d0b5 OP_EQUAL
address
3DrDW5we4HqhbD16r4Ahu6dAPhsqkvMKkA
transaction
bcecc7919274a3aa11a14ccfbf66f8c975937e2ea6be4a1873fd77a9b1405606
spent
true